Data visualization researchers face several challenges when trying to build an interface that is both informative and user-friendly. Three such challenges are:

  • Difficulty in starting the design process due to numerous data types and user requirements.
  • Deciding the appropriate level of background information to include without overwhelming the user.
  • Choosing the right technical terms and concepts to explain, ensuring that it's neither too complex nor too simplistic for the target audience.

To address these problems, researchers can:

  • Use graphical methods to conceptualize and create preliminary designs, ensuring that data taken from these methods is accurate to three digits.
  • Consider the visual representation of data, like infographics or charts, to make the information accessible to a wider audience.
  • Ensure that visuals and media are clear, concise, and high quality to avoid misinterpretation and provide a better user experience.
